Bharat Forge Bags Gold at CSR Times Awards for Rural Development
Share Share Share Share

Through a holistic approach that addresses key indicators of well-being, Bharat Forge’s CSR is making a tangible difference in the lives of countless individuals and communities in Maharashtra.

PUNE (India CSR): In a momentous occasion, Bharat Forge Limited, a leading global manufacturing company, was honoured with the prestigious Gold Award in the Rural Development category at the CSR Times Awards 2024 on August 23, 2024. The esteemed award was presented by Dr. Pramod Sawant, the Chief Minister of Goa, at a glittering ceremony held in the majestic Darbar Hall of Raj Bhawan. 

This recognition underscores Bharat Forge’s unwavering commitment to creating a positive and sustainable impact on the lives of people residing in rural areas across multiple key indicators.

At Bharat Forge, under the leadership of Shri Babasaheb Kalyani, CMD, and Shri Amit Kalyani, Vice Chairman and JMD, the company is deeply committed to enhancing rural livelihoods. Through focused initiatives, Bharat Forge aims to drive sustainable social impact, fostering long-term benefits for communities and contributing to overall societal development.

The award ceremony was attended by prominent business leaders, government officials, and social sector experts. 

Bharat Forge’s Rural Development Initiatives: Five Key Indicators

Bharat Forge’s rural development initiatives have made a significant impact in the areas of water conservation, livelihood enhancement, healthcare, education, and Accessibility. 

Bharat Forge Bags Gold at CSR Times Awards for Rural Development

These projects demonstrate the company’s commitment to community well-being through sustainable development. Below are five key indicators that highlight the effectiveness and reach of Bharat Forge’s rural initiatives.

1. Water Harvesting: Improving Availability and Productivity

Bharat Forge has implemented various water harvesting projects, resulting in improved water availability for agriculture and household use in several villages. Key initiatives include the construction of Bandharas and desilting of water bodies in villages such as Chilewadi, Amondi, and Wagholi, where water storage capacities have increased significantly.

  • Impact: For instance, the project at Wagholi benefited over 6,900 people, adding 75 TCM of water storage capacity. In Visapur, over 4,600 people gained from improved water availability due to the construction of Bandharas.
  • Results: These projects have not only increased agricultural productivity but also improved livelihoods by enabling farmers to grow multiple crops annually, thus enhancing food security and income.

2. Livelihood Opportunities: Converting Barren Land into Fertile Fields

Bharat Forge has successfully transformed barren lands into fertile ones through levelling efforts. The CSR initiatives have enhanced agricultural output and improved the livelihood of farmers by providing training in modern agricultural practices and creating access to better markets.

  • Impact: In 2023-24 alone, over 1554 gunthas of barren land were leveled, benefiting 105 farmers.
  • Results: The transformation has led to an increase in the average annual household income, with returns on investment (ROI) reaching up to 122% by 2021-22.

3. Health: Bringing Quality Healthcare to Rural Areas

Bharat Forge’s healthcare initiatives focus on early detection, particularly through cancer screening camps and telemedicine centers across eight villages. These telemedicine centers provide access to quality healthcare services, including consultations, diagnostics, and follow-up care, ensuring residents in remote areas receive essential medical attention.

  • Impact: For instance, the introduction of telemedicine centres has made healthcare more accessible for over eight villages, significantly reducing the need for long-distance travel to seek medical services.
  • Results: Community feedback and engagement ensure that healthcare programs are tailored to local needs, improving overall health outcomes in the targeted areas.

4. Education: Enhancing Infrastructure for Schools

In its education-focused initiatives, Bharat Forge has worked to improve school infrastructure, benefiting students across various villages. By constructing classrooms, building toilet units, and maintaining essential facilities, the company has improved the learning environment for hundreds of students.

  • Impact: For instance, the construction of two classrooms in Vanpuri village directly benefited over 120 students. Similarly, new toilet units built in Gurholi benefited over 380 students.
  • Results: These infrastructure improvements have created a more conducive learning environment, encouraging better attendance and enhancing the overall educational experience.

5. Easy Accessibility: Developing Rural Infrastructure

Bharat Forge has focused on constructing internal roads in rural areas, improving connectivity and accessibility for residents. These efforts are crucial for facilitating mobility, trade, and access to essential services.

  • Impact: For instance, in Hiware village the construction of a 210-meter road benefited over 1,900 people. Similar projects in Bopgaon and Bhiwari enhanced accessibility for thousands of residents.
  • Results: Better roads have improved the overall quality of life for villagers, allowing easier access to markets, healthcare facilities, and educational institutions.

A Proud Moment for Bharat Forge

Receiving the Gold Award in the Rural Development category is a reflection of Bharat Forge’s steadfast commitment to creating positive change in rural India. Baba Kalyani, Chairman and Managing Director of Bharat Forge, said, “We are deeply honoured to receive this award. It is a true testament to our ongoing commitment to uplifting rural communities. Bharat Forge remains dedicated to creating long-term social impact and driving positive change through our CSR initiatives.”
